THE OPPORTUNITY
Due to growth, we are currently seeking a Contract Administrator to join our Girraween projects team. With your expertise, you will provide administrative support to construction projects, working with the delivery team to ensure key milestones are met.
As a highly organised professional, you will prepare management reports, compile job site packages for field crew, maintain various databases in a timely manner and process timesheets for field and office team members. You’ll be supported by a great team of people including the Project Managers, Project Engineers, Site Supervisors and Field Crew.
Key Selection Criteria:
- Previous experience in a similar role, ideally within the construction or related industry
- The ability to work autonomously in a busy work environment
- Strong computer skills with intermediate to advanced skills in MS office suite
- Timely and accurate data entry skills
- Excellent communication skills and the proven ability to interface within a team environment
- Alignment with our core values of Honesty, Reliability, Competence and Respect
